Weather in September

The first month of the autumn, September, is still a tropical month in Blanton, Florida, with an average temperature ranging between max 88.2°F (31.2°C) and min 73.8°F (23.2°C).

Temperature

September's average high-temperature stands at a still tropical 88.2°F (31.2°C), showing little deviation from August's 90.1°F (32.3°C). In Blanton, the nighttime temperature averages to a moderately hot 73.8°F (23.2°C) during September.

Heat index

September's mean heat index is computed to be a blistering 105.8°F (41°C). Additional precautions are required to avert heat cramps and heat exhaustion. Persistent activity may culminate in heatstroke.
Thinking about the heat index, one should account for its values in shaded areas with gentle breezes. The heat index could see an increase by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ees under direct sunshine.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'apparent temperature' or 'feels like', is a composite of temperature and humidity figures to convey how warm it feels. One's weather perception can be influenced by a range of factors including metabolic differences, being pregnant, and their level of physical activity. Keep aware, the sun, when shining directly, can intensify the heat experience, pushing the heat index up by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are highly critical for babies and toddlers. Children frequently do not understand the need for recuperation and hydration. Thirst, being a late manifestation of dehydration, underlines the need to hydrate frequently, especially when engaging in prolonged physical exercises.
For the human body, perspiration is the go-to method to regulate temperature, using sweat's evaporation to dissipate warmth. When the level of relative humidity is elevated, evaporation diminishes, causing more warmth to be retained in the body than in dry air. Overheating and potential dehydration arise when body heat gain eclipses its release capability.

Humidity

August and September, with an average relative humidity of 79%, are the most humid months in Blanton.

Rainfall

In Blanton, in September, during 24.4 rainfall days, 4.45" (113mm) of precipitation is typically accumulated. In Blanton, Florida, during the entire year, the rain falls for 200.6 days and collects up to 40.39" (1026mm) of precipitation.

UV index

The months with the highest UV index are May through July and September, with an average maximum UV index of 7. A UV Index estimate of 6 to 7 represents a high health vulnerability from unsafe exposure to UV radiation for the average person.
Note: An average UV index of 7 in September transforms into this advice:
Escape overexposure. People with light skin may incur burns in fewer than 20 minutes. Avoid direct Sun exposure and stay in the shade between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m., a time when UV radiation is most intense, noting that not all shade structures offer full protection. For effective sun eye protection, rely on sunglasses certified for UVA and UVB resistance.
